Alist interior designer Peter Dunhams first book reveals his singular approach to colorful, patternfilled interiors with worldclass photography of neverbeforeseen projectsPeter Dunham is a Los Angelesbased interior designer known for his bold use of color and pattern, sophisticated yet casual style, and a timeless feeling. The Wall Street Journal described his style as Merchant Ivory Moderne and restraint with a kick. The World of Peter Dunham features a dozen of Dunhams most recent projects, ranging from chic New York City penthouses to sunkissed California gems, as well as Dunhams own residences, including his Paris piedterre. Each chapters rich imagery illuminates a tenet of his design ethosColor, Rhythm, Togetherness, Naturealong with the people and places that have shaped his unique point of view. Here is a dynamic mix of projects, many featuring Dunhams internationally acclaimed textiles, all presented in stunning photographs. Dunham and his design team split their time between restoring older houses and collaborating with renowned architects on brandnew residences. Current projects include a modernist Marmol Radziner house overlooking the Pacific in Montecito, residences in Los Angeles, the Bay Area, Newport Beach, New York City, Dallas, Sag Harbor, Montana, and an iconic 1963 Horace Gifford house on Fire Island.
